Ghost shark vs Patton’s Nectar Bat
Hydrolagus pallidus compared with Hsunycteris pattoni
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Ghost shark | Patton’s Nectar Bat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(cordados) | Chordata (cordados) |
| Class | Holocephali (Holocephali) | Mammalia (mamíferos) |
| Order | Chimaeriformes (Chimaeriformes) | Chiroptera (Bats) |
| Family | Chimaeridae | Phyllostomidae |
| Genus | Hydrolagus | Hsunycteris |
| Species | Hydrolagus pallidus | Hsunycteris pattoni |
Evolutionary Relationship
Ghost shark and Patton’s Nectar Bat share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(cordados)
